Why is General Motors the largest industrial company in the world?

Founded in 1908, General Motors has been the largest industrial company in the world for nearly 50 years. It has more than 65,438+030 factories and more than 700,000 employees in the United States. There are more than 60 wholly-owned or joint ventures overseas. From 65438 to 0992, GM sold more than 7 million cars worldwide, accounting for one-sixth of the total global car sales.

1993 At the International Automobile Exhibition held in Beijing, a super-long luxury Cadillac made by General Motors was particularly eye-catching: it was equipped with a bar, refrigerator, Simmons, bathtub and closed-circuit TV. It is said that this brand-name car has become a symbol of identity and status. American presidents such as Roosevelt, Eisenhower, Nixon, Reagan, George H.W. Bush, and current President Clinton all chose Cadillac as their presidential car. Cadillac produced by General Motors has formed a series of dozens of models, and new models come out every year.

Buick is also the fist product of GM with a long history. Since the establishment of the company, Buick has become famous all over the world. 1984, Buick sales exceeded1000000, becoming one of the financial pillars of GM.

At present, GM * * * produces 1 1 series of cars and trucks, totaling 100. 1 1 series are Cadillac, Buick, Chevrolet, Pontiac, Saturn and so on.

General Motors, like other large multinational companies in the world, regards automobile production as the most important department, and is also involved in insurance, electronics, information and other industries.

General Motors attaches great importance to the China market, and has established Jinbei General Motors Manufacturing Company in Shenyang, and established several joint ventures in China to produce auto parts.
